The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) program is authorized under Title I of the Housing and Community Development Act of 1974, as amended. The primary goal of the CDBG program, as outlined by Title I is
"…is the development of viable urban communities, by providing decent housing and suitable living environment and expanding economic opportunities, principally for persons of low and moderate income."

The City’s CDBG program year runs from May 1st through April 30th. During this period, the City or subgrantees undertake projects and activities that were included in the HUD required annual Action Plan, which is approved by the Common Council after reviews by the Plan Commission.  A public hearing is held annually at the Oshkosh Seniors Center to discuss the draft Action Plan and receive public comments on the proposed activities.

CDBG program guidelines are fairly flexible and allow for many activities to be undertaken as part of the program as long as a national objective is being met by the activity being undertaken as well as being consistent with the City’s 2005 – 2009 Consolidated Plan and the Comprehensive Plan. Eligible activities can broadly be categorized as follows:

  • Housing
  • Economic Development/Central City Redevelopment
  • Public Services 
  • Planning
  • Administration
  • Public Facilities and Improvements

While the City undertakes activities on its own relative to the above categories, it also provides grant assistance to individuals and organizations proposing to undertake eligible activities that meet a national objective as well as priorities found in the City’s 2005 – 2009 Consolidated Plan
